      Description

      Product Overview. The Tuff Country 4-Inch Rear Lift Blocks provide a reliable method to raise the rear suspension height on vehicles equipped with leaf springs. By increasing ground clearance and improving vehicle stance, these blocks also help enhance load capacity and facilitate the use of larger tires.

      Construction and Appearance. Made from durable cast iron, these lift blocks are engineered to withstand heavy loads and harsh driving conditions. Their consistent, non-tapered shape ensures an even lift and stable support, making them a dependable component for your suspension system.

      Installation. Installation is straightforward, requiring only basic mechanical skills. No drilling or modifications are necessary, allowing for a clean upgrade that maintains the vehicle’s structural integrity.

      Application. These lift blocks are designed to fit the rear axle of Silverado 3500 HD models from 2007 through 2010 without any need for additional modifications.
